Business Analyst (Data & AI Readiness) | About You

As a Business Analyst (Data & AI Readiness), you will lead discovery, assessment, and documentation efforts to help organizations evaluate their data landscape and readiness for AI-driven initiatives. You will work closely with business stakeholders and technical teams to understand current-state processes, data sources, document management practices, and information architecture, translating findings into actionable recommendations. This is a highly client-facing role that requires strong communication, stakeholder management, business analysis, and data project experience.

Business Analyst (Data & AI Readiness) | Day-to-Day

  • Facilitate discovery sessions and stakeholder interviews to assess business processes, data sources, document repositories, and AI readiness requirements.
  • Gather, analyze, and document business, functional, and data requirements, ensuring alignment between business objectives and technology solutions.
  • Evaluate current-state information management, data governance, and content management processes, identifying opportunities for optimization and AI enablement.
  • Create detailed documentation, process maps, requirements artifacts, gap analyses, and recommendations for future-state solutions.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including business stakeholders, data specialists, solution architects, and delivery teams, to support project objectives.
  • Communicate project status, findings, risks, and recommendations to stakeholders while ensuring timely completion of project deliverables.

Business Analyst (Data & AI Readiness) | Skills & Experience

  • 5+ years of experience as a Business Analyst, with a strong track record of leading discovery, requirements gathering, and stakeholder engagement initiatives.
  • Experience supporting data, analytics, data governance, or digital transformation projects, including process analysis and documentation of data-related requirements.
  • Strong client-facing consulting skills, with the ability to facilitate workshops, conduct interviews, and communicate effectively with both business and technical audiences.
  • Proven experience creating business requirements documents, process flows, current-state/future-state assessments, gap analyses, and executive-level deliverables.
  • Excellent analytical, organizational, and communication skills, with the ability to work independently and collaborate across geographically distributed teams.
